Abstract

The utility model discloses a neurology massage device, which comprises a massage bed and massage ball connectors, wherein sliding guide rails are arranged on two sides of the massage bed and are in sliding connection with vertical lifting rods, the vertical lifting rods are in nested connection with a cross rod, the height of the cross rod can be fixed or adjusted by utilizing bolts, the massage ball connectors are in sliding connection with the cross rod through moving sliding grooves, four massage balls driven by motors are arranged under each massage ball connector, and through the combination of the forward and backward movement of the vertical lifting rods on the sliding guide rails, the lifting movement of the cross rod on the vertical lifting rods and the horizontal movement of the massage ball connectors on the cross rod, the position of the massage balls can be adjusted, so that the massage balls can accurately massage the massage positions of patients at different positions; the upper surface of the massage bed is provided with a heating groove, and a reinforcing plate, a heating pad and a cover plate are arranged in the heating groove, so that the massage bed has a constant-temperature heating function, and the phenomenon that the skin of a patient directly contacts the massage bed is cold is avoided.

Description

Department of neurology massage device
Technical Field
The utility model belongs to the field of medical instruments, and particularly relates to a massage device for neurology.
Background
In the treatment process of neurology, further massage nursing is needed to be carried out on a patient generally, but at present, most medical staff adopt a manual mode to massage the patient to promote recovery, but long-term high-labor-intensity massage can enable the medical staff to feel extremely tired, the massage range of the conventional massage device in the market is not wide, the patients with different heights and weights are massaged at different positions, the optimal massage effect is difficult to be exerted, and the constant-temperature heating function is not provided.
Disclosure of utility model
In order to solve the problems that in the prior art, the massage range of a massage device is not wide, the universality is not enough, the optimal massage effect is difficult to be better exerted on patients with different heights, the massage device does not have a heating function, and the comfort level of the use of the patients is low, the utility model provides the neurology massage device, the massage ball can be adjusted according to the massage position of the patients, and the massage device also has a constant-temperature heating device, so that the condition that the skin of the patients is directly contacted with discomfort is avoided.
In order to solve the technical problems, the utility model adopts the following scheme: the utility model provides a department of neurology massage device, includes massage bed and massage mechanism, the sliding guide has been seted up to the both sides of massage bed, sliding connection has two perpendicular lifter in the sliding guide, nested connection horizontal pole between two perpendicular lifter, the horizontal pole both sides are provided with the removal spout, remove spout sliding connection has two massage ball connecting pieces, the bolt fixed connection in massage ball connecting piece bottom the installation shell of massage ball, the massage ball top is in the fixed connection spring in the installation shell, the other end fixed connection transmission piece of spring, install the transmission piece top the motor to the reciprocating motion about motor drive massage ball; the massage balls can reach any position on the massage bed to massage through the sliding of the vertical lifting rod on the sliding guide rail, the sliding of the cross rod on the vertical lifting rod and the sliding of the massage ball connecting piece on the moving chute; the upper surface of the massage bed is provided with a through heating groove, the heating groove comprises a reinforcing plate, a heating pad and a cover plate, and when the massage bed is used, the temperature of the upper surface of the massage bed is maintained at the normal body temperature through the heating pad; the upper surface of the massage bed is provided with a circular through groove, and the lower surface of the massage bed is fixedly connected with four support columns through bolts.
Further, the vertical lifting rod is connected with the cross rod in a nested manner, the cross rod can slide up and down in the vertical lifting rod, penetrating round holes are formed in the two sides of the vertical lifting rod at equal intervals, the through round holes of the cross rod and the vertical lifting rod are penetrated by inserting bolts, so that the cross rod is fixed, and when the height of the cross rod needs to be adjusted, the bolts are pulled out to be adjusted.
Further, the reinforcing plates, the heating pads and the cover plate are arranged in the heating groove from bottom to top in sequence, and the reinforcing plates are hollow, so that the heating pads radiate heat to prevent overheating; the heating pad is adhered to the lower surface of the cover plate, but the contact surface of the cover plate and the reinforcing plate is not adhered with the heating pad; the cover plate is fixedly connected with the upper surface of the massage bed through countersunk bolts, and the temperature of the cover plate and the upper surface of the massage bed is maintained at the normal body temperature through supplying power to the heating pad for heating.
Further, two massage ball connecting pieces are slidably connected to the movable sliding chute, four massage balls are connected under the massage ball connecting pieces, bolts at the bottoms of the massage ball connecting pieces are fixedly connected with the installation shell of the massage balls, springs are fixedly connected in the installation shell, compression springs are fixedly installed around the joints of the massage balls and the springs, upward elastic force is provided for the massage balls, a transmission block is fixedly connected to the other ends of the springs, a motor is installed above the transmission block, the transmission block is rotationally compressed by a motor driving rotary output piece until the two tops are contacted, the massage balls extend out to the longest, then the transmission block is reset under the compression of the springs, the massage balls retract, the motor driving massage balls can be circularly and reciprocally moved up and down, and the operation speed of the motor is controlled so that the massage strength of the massage balls can be controlled.

Detailed Description
The following description of the embodiments of the present utility model will be made apparent and fully in view of the accompanying drawings, in which some, but not all embodiments of the utility model are shown. All other embodiments, which can be made by those skilled in the art based on the embodiments of the utility model without making any inventive effort, are intended to be within the scope of the utility model.
As shown in fig. 1-4, the massage device for neurology comprises a massage bed 1 and massage ball connectors 2, wherein sliding guide rails 101 are arranged on two sides of the massage bed 1, two vertical lifting rods 102 are connected in a sliding manner in the sliding guide rails 101, the vertical lifting rods 102 are connected with a cross rod 103 in a sliding manner, and the vertical lifting rods 102 are connected with the cross rod 103 in a nesting manner; the two sides of the cross bar 103 are provided with movable sliding grooves 104, the movable sliding grooves 104 are connected with two massage ball connecting pieces 2 in a sliding manner, the bottom of each massage ball connecting piece 2 is fixedly connected with a mounting shell 206 of each massage ball through bolts, the top ends of the massage balls 201 are fixedly connected with springs 202 in the mounting shells 206, the other ends of the springs 202 are fixedly connected with transmission blocks 203, a motor 204 is arranged above the transmission blocks 203, and the motor 204 drives the massage balls 201 to reciprocate up and down; the massage balls 2 can reach any position on the massage bed 1 for massage by sliding the vertical lifting rod 102 back and forth on the sliding guide rail 101, sliding the cross rod 103 up and down on the vertical lifting rod 102 and sliding the massage ball connecting piece 2 left and right on the moving chute 104; a through heating groove 105 is arranged on the upper surface of the massage bed 1, the heating groove 105 comprises a reinforcing plate 301, a heating pad 302 and a cover plate 303, and when the massage bed 1 is used, the temperature of the upper surface of the massage bed is raised and maintained at the normal body temperature through the heating pad 302; the circular through groove 106 has been seted up to massage bed upper surface, massage bed lower surface bolted connection is fixed with four support columns 107, has solved the problem that "the massage scope of current massage device in the market is not extensive, massages different positions to the patient of different heights weight, is difficult to exert the best massage effect, does not possess the function of constant temperature heating" that mentions in the background art.
The vertical lifting rod 102 is connected with the cross rod 103 in a nested manner, the cross rod 103 can slide up and down in the vertical lifting rod 102, through round holes 108 are formed in the two sides of the vertical lifting rod 102 at equal distance, through bolts 109 can be inserted to penetrate through the cross rod 103 and the through round holes 108 of the vertical lifting rod 102, so that the cross rod is fixed, and when the height of the cross rod needs to be adjusted, the bolts 109 are pulled out to be adjusted.
The reinforcing plate 301, the heating pad 302 and the cover plate 303 are installed in the heating tank 105 in sequence from bottom to top, and the reinforcing plates 301 are hollow, so that heat is dissipated from the heating pad 302, and scalding caused by excessive heating is prevented; the heating pad 302 is adhered to the lower surface of the cover plate 303, but the contact surface of the cover plate 303 and the reinforcing plate 301 is not adhered with the heating pad 302; the cover plate 303 is fixedly connected with the upper surface of the massage bed through countersunk bolts.
The movable sliding chute is slidably connected with two massage ball connectors 2, the bottom of each massage ball connector 2 is fixedly connected with a mounting shell 206 of each massage ball, the top end of each massage ball 201 is fixedly connected with a spring 202 in the mounting shell 206, compression springs 207 are fixedly arranged around the joints of each massage ball 201 and each spring 202, upward elastic force is provided for each massage ball 201, the other end of each spring 202 is fixedly connected with a transmission block 203, a motor 204 is arranged above each transmission block 203, a rotary output piece 205 is driven by the motor 204 to rotationally compress each transmission block 203 until the two top ends are contacted, each massage ball 201 stretches out to the longest extent, the transmission blocks 203 are reset under the compression of the corresponding compression springs 207, each massage ball 201 is retracted, the motor 204 can drive each massage ball 201 to move up and down by circulation, and the operation speed of each motor 204 is controlled so that the massage strength of each massage ball 201 can be controlled.
The specific using steps are as follows: when the massage bed 1 is used, the heating pad 302 is electrified firstly, so that the temperature of the upper surface of the massage bed is heated and maintained to the normal body temperature, then the front surface of a patient is enabled to lie on the upper surface of the massage bed, the head is placed in the circular through groove 106, the vertical lifting rod 102 is pushed to slide back and forth in the sliding guide rail 101 at two sides of the massage bed to be parallel to the massage position and fixed, the massage ball connecting piece 2 is pushed to slide left and right in the moving sliding groove 104, the massage ball 201 is positioned right above the massage position and fixed, finally the bolt 109 of the vertical lifting rod is pulled out, the cross rod 103 is pushed to slide up and down in the vertical lifting rod 102, the massage ball connecting piece 2 is enabled to reach the optimal massage position, the bolt 109 is inserted and fixed, the massage frequency of the massage ball 201 is adjusted, and then the position of the massage ball 201 is adjusted according to different conditions to perform more efficient massage and constant temperature heating functions.
